    I'm in St. Louis and I breed. I don't have much right now since it's the off season, but I should have a good selection of morphs in a few months.

    I have issues with Exotic Arc, but that is my thing. Ben Renick has some AMAZING animals, and he's great all around guy. There is also St. Louis Reptiles, Bob is a great guy with very nice stock. I have one of his snakes. Brent with BRB reptiles is another good guy with some really cool stuff. There is also a great reptile show here, where you can meet most of these terrific people, the next one is in March. Here's a link to their site. http://www.stlreptileshow.com/

    This show sometimes draws some of the bigger guys from out of state. Southwest Wisconsin Reptiles was there last time. Rodent Pro also comes to this show.
